[SlimDevices: Plugins] Spotty and playlist folders

2019-01-03 Thread mherger


Unfortunately Spotify seems to have decided NOT to support playlist
folders through the API (see
https://github.com/spotify/web-api/issues/38#issuecomment-396925978).
But there's a potential workaround - undocumented and ugly. But it might
work (using this method:
https://github.com/spotify/web-api/issues/38#issuecomment-431600563).
Unfortunately that latter workaround would only work if Spotify was
running on the same machine as LMS/Spotty. Or maybe with some more
workarounds the information could be transferred from another computer
to be used in Spotty... Therefore I'm asking you:

I run LMS/Spotty on the same computer as a Spotify desktop app.
I don't run LMS/Spotty and Spotify on the same computer, but would be
willing to run some script every now and then to transfer folder
information.
I wouldn't want to deal with this mess, even if I'd love to use
folders.
What's a playlist folder?
